Which engine can get higher mileage- rotary or piston?

Generally, piston engines tend to achieve higher mileage than rotary engines. Here's why:

* Fuel efficiency: Piston engines are more efficient in converting fuel into power. This is due to their four-stroke cycle, which allows for better air-fuel mixing and combustion. Rotary engines, with their unique design, struggle to achieve the same level of efficiency.

* Compression ratio: Piston engines typically have higher compression ratios than rotary engines. This allows them to extract more energy from the fuel.

* Friction: Rotary engines have more moving parts and experience higher friction, leading to energy loss and reduced efficiency.

* Power output: For a given displacement, rotary engines typically produce less power than piston engines. This means they require more fuel to achieve the same performance.

However, it's important to note that:

* Advancements in technology: Both rotary and piston engines have seen significant advancements in recent years, leading to improved fuel efficiency in both types.

* Driving style: The mileage you achieve will also depend on factors like driving habits, vehicle weight, and road conditions.

While rotary engines might offer a unique driving experience and higher revving capabilities, they typically fall behind piston engines in terms of fuel economy.
